This necklace gives the wearer that he or she wants there is no intervention in the event of failure. Aid workers are required by law to comply with that wish.
The number of people applying for the medal, increased from 1,200 in 2007 to more than five thousand last year. According to the Dutch Association for Voluntary-Life (NVVE) that the penny spend, this is because more and more people consciously think about the end of their lives.
Among the carriers are especially many people over 70 with a relatively good health, who want to avoid being permanently damaged by a resuscitation, the AD reports
